Description

Ibuprofen CAS NO 58560-75-1 is a widely recognized non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drug (NSAID) and a key active pharmaceutical ingredient (API). It is valued for its potent analgesic, anti-inflammatory, and antipyretic properties, making it a cornerstone in pain management and fever reduction. This high-quality API is essential for pharmaceutical manufacturers producing over-the-counter and prescription medications, including tablets, capsules, and topical formulations, for the global healthcare market.

Application

  • Pharmaceutical API: Primary active ingredient in solid oral dosage forms such as tablets and capsules for pain and inflammation relief.
  • Analgesic Formulations: Used in combination products for headaches, dental pain, menstrual cramps, and minor arthritis pain.
  • Pediatric Medications: Incorporated into suspensions and chewable tablets designed for children's fever and pain management.
  • Topical Preparations: Utilized in gels, creams, and patches for localized pain relief with reduced systemic exposure.
  • Veterinary Medicine: Applied in veterinary pharmaceuticals for managing pain and inflammation in animals.
  • Clinical Research: Serves as a reference standard and raw material in pharmacological studies and drug development.

Basic Information

Product Name Ibuprofen
CAS No. 58560-75-1
Molecular Formula C13H18O2
Molecular Weight 206.28 g/mol
Synonyms (±)-2-(4-Isobutylphenyl)propionic acid; 4-Isobutyl-α-methylphenylacetic acid; p-Isobutylhydratropic acid; Advil; Motrin; Nurofen; Brufen; Rufen; Ibuprohm; IBU

Specification

Item Specification
Appearance White or almost white crystalline powder
Identification (IR) Conforms
Identification (HPLC) Conforms
Assay (HPLC) 99.0% - 101.0%
Related Substances (HPLC) Individual impurity ≤ 0.1%; Total impurities ≤ 0.5%
Heavy Metals ≤ 20 ppm
Residue on Ignition ≤ 0.1%
Loss on Drying ≤ 0.5%
Optical Rotation -0.05° to +0.05°
Particle Size Distribution Upon request
